Top 4 Las Vegas pools to enjoy during your trip

by julianna aquino

There are millions of activities you can do in Sin City, but once you have covered all the typical tourist attractions we recommend you to take your bathing suit and visit a few pools. We have rounded up the top 4 ones you have to check out!

  1. Mandalay Bay

Around Mandalay Bay’s Daylight Beach Club you can encounter three big pools, a lazy river and a wave pool. What else can you ask for? Additionally, you will have 2,700 tons of gleaming white sand over which you could sunbathe. Incredible right?

  1. The Golden Nugget

Right in this resort and hotel casino, you can swim besides a shark tank. This pool aquarium has even a waterslide that goes through the shark tank, which gives you the opportunity to look at the animals closer. On the other side, if you prefer a child-free pool, you can go to the one called the Hideout, which doesn’t allow people under-16s.

  1. Hard Rock Hotel and Casino

For the young people who like to party a lot, this resort and hotel casino offers 3 different pools, from which 2 of them are only for people over 21. We recommend you to check out what parties there are going on and which musicians will be playing before you go.

  1. Caesars Palace

They offer 8 different pools which each of them are named as a roman deity. For a historical experience don’t stop visiting at least one of these incredible themed pools. On the other side, if you are traveling to Las Vegas with kids check out the FlowRider wave simulator located at Planet Hollywood. They would have fun a lot!
